0

meta_value でワードプレスの post_meta テーブルをクエリしようとしています。

meta_value が = であるすべての post_id を _parent_product に出力したいと思います。これが私のコードです:

$posts = $wpdb->get_results("SELECT *, FROM $table WHERE meta_key='_parent_product' ");
foreach ( $posts as $post ){

$id = $post->post_id;

echo $id;

}

上記は何も出力しませんが、その理由はよくわかりません。誰でも何か間違ったことを見ることができますか?

4

1 に答える 1

1

コメントで述べたように、

,の後ろにコンマ () がありますSELECT *,。そのため、指定された SQL は無効であり、結果の取得に失敗します。

于 2013-08-05T12:44:11.620 に答える